💡 Overview

Sogeumganggyegok Valley is located on the east side of Odaesan Mountain. The valley is also referred to as Cheonghak Dongsogeum because the scenery resembles a crane (cheonghak) spreading its wings. The rock formations standing in between the lush valley forests will draw the eyes of any visitor. Several attractions are found along the valley path such as Mureunggyegok Valley, Myeonggyeongdae Post, Guryongpokpo Falls, Gunjapokpo Falls, and more.

[Tour Course Information]
Durobong Course (4 hours 40 min / 10 km)

Jingogae – Dongdaesan Mountain – Durobong – Duroryeong

Dongdaesan Mountain Course (2 hours 10 min / 4.4 km)

Dongpigol – Dongdaesan Mountain – Jingogae

Sangwangbong Course (5 hours 20 min / 14 km)

Sangwonsa Temple – Birobong – Sangwangbong – Duroryeong – Bukdaesa – Sangwonsa Temple

Sogeumgang River Course (7 hours / 13.3 km)

Mureunggae – Sibjaso – Yeonghwadam – Sikdangam – Guryongpokpo Falls – Manmulsang – Baekundae – Nakyeongpokpo Falls – Noinbong – Jingogae

Birobong Course (1 hour 40 min / 3.5 km)
Sangwonsa Temple – Jungdaesa Temple – Jeokmyeolbogung – Birobong
